TKM SCHOLARSHIP WINNER TAKES FIRST S1 WIN

 TKM Extreme scholarship winner Matt England put on a dominant display in the first round of this year’s TKM National S1 Championships exactly a year on from his debut last year.

 He was fastest in qualifying, won both heats and set a new lap record at Llandow. His only mistake cost him victory in the first final when he was well in the lead and went off. So in the second final he started at the back but still came through to win.

 Driving a Tal-Ko Veloce kart powered with the latest spec big bearing direct drive engine also prepared by Tal-Ko, he left a string of experienced drivers trying to hang onto his tail including last year’s champion Joe Forsdyke, also on a Tal-Ko Veloce kart.

 Tal-Ko boss Alan Turney said: “It was a fantastic dominant display from Matt. He has come on a great deal since his debut last year and this performance underlines why we felt he was a worthy scholarship winner last year.”

Matt England said: The Veloce kart and Tal-Ko prepared engine were unbelievable.  The motor just pulled and pulled and I could also enter and exit every corner quicker than the others which led to me breaking the lap record three times over the weekend. I cannot wait for the next round at Buckmore.”

 

 

 

 

 

 

 SUPER ONE SERIES OFFERS GREAT DEAL TO TKM DRIVERS

TKM drivers are being offered a great deal in the S1 series, not least of which is the opportunity to win one of the coveted seeded numbers 1 – 10, exclusive to the series. 

Last year the organisers were delighted to announce that the class national champions in TKM Extreme and Junior TKM will receive a fully paid up Super One season. And that great prize continues for 2015. All the race entry fees, the registration fee, dry race and one set of wet tyres and fuel costs will be covered for them in 2016 thanks to the generosity of Tal-Ko.  

The series is televised on Motors TV and also available in High Definition on YouTube so your sponsors, friends and family can all enjoy your racing exploits at a time to suit them.  With Tal-Ko’s generosity the entry fee per round is discounted at just £160. 

Worth over £2500 this is a prize very much worth aiming for during the season, whether experienced TKM or a newcomer.  The Super One offers excellent value for money, probably the best of any similar national or international series and all details are on www.superoneseries.com.

The Super One promoters are delighted to announce that privateers will be awarded in the 2015 season ahead with trophies for the top privateer in each class championship.  Prizes for the TKM classes will be announced in due course.  Singleton privateers who are not in a team awning should register with the promoter John Hoyle at the first round, to stake their claim for the new trophies and awards. Registering will not affect their eligibility for the top Rookie awards, given out at each round and at the end of season, which have their own amazing prizes.
